In our top story, Wizards of the Coast, the company responsible for the Pokémon Collectible Card Game, is being bought out by Hasbro. This buyout will bring Hasbro into a new industry. Second, Nintendo of America has announced a US release date for Pokémon 2, September 2000. This means that we certainately won't see Pokémon 3 for the launch of Game Boy Advance, scheduled to be released just a few months thereafter. In other game news, the next Pokémon game after yellow will be released next spring. In keeping with the two word limit, the came will be called Pokémon Card, and be based on the card game. This weekend, the Kid's WB sent out an unheard of seven episodes of Pokémon. It also features another new episode, which was nice. Next weekend, there will be two new episodes. Anyway, in case you need to know which fast-food restaurant to blame for weight gain this November, the answer is Burger King. The food chain will be featuring toys from Pokémon: The First Movie starting November 8th. Also in movie news, Nintendo has announced plans to release a second movie in the US.
